Comic BomBom began publication with the November 1981 issue (released October 15) with a focus on the Mobile Suit Gundam robot war series. Specifically, it helped expand the "Gundam Boom" by running a manga about competing young plastic model builders called PlaMo Kyōshirō, as well as Super Deformed Gundam and the samurai-influenced Musha Gundam. BonBon was known for serializing many media tie-ins aimed at children such as Rockman (Megaman), and Medarot (Medabots).

Japanese publisher Kodansha ceased publication of Comic BomBom due to declining readership. The December 2007 issue (released November 15) is its last issue.

Comic BomBom sold 750,000 copies of the April 1991 issue. BonBon sold 98,000 copies a month in 2006 (when it cut its page count by half). In 2007 sales fell into the range of 50,000 copies.
